La. waste operator arrested

June 2009

U.S. Water News Online

BATON ROUGE, La. — A Louisiana waste operator has been arrested on charges he dumped untreated wastewater on the ground near his facility in Vacherie.

The state Department of Environmental Quality says 45-year-old Charles Earnest Toth also is accused of making false statements on forms he submitted to the department.

The department's criminal investigation division arrested Toth.

Toth allegedly bypassed the treatment facility on his property before dumping loads of wastewater. The department said samples of soil taken from his land contained chemicals related to oil and petroleum products.
